4.18
Crypto Menu
This sub-menu allows you to manage SIM card based End-to-End Encryption.
The End-to-End Encryption is used for:
• Encryption of voice transmission in the DMO and TMO Modes.
• Encryption of messages transmission in the TMO Mode.
• Encryption of messages transmission in the DMO Mode (the radio cannot be in call).
• Encryption of position data (GPS) transmission in the TMO and DMO Modes.
• Transfer of Operational Tactical Address (OPTA) in the TMO and DMO Modes.
• Management of encryption keys in the TMO Mode.
4.18.1
Enabling or Disabling SIM Card End-to-End Encryption
Prerequisites:
Ensure that:
• The SIM card is inserted in the radio.
• The radio is not in an active call.
• You cannot press the PTT button.
Procedure:
To enable or disable the SIM card End-to-End Encryption, choose one of the following ways:
If… Then…
If the One-Touch button is configured by
your service provider,
press the One-Touch button.
If you want to operate from the menu, perform the following actions:
a Press Menu→Crypto Menu→Crypto
Function.
b Select Encryption On to enable or En-
cryption Off to disable encryption.
Your radio displays prompts indicating your current encryption state: an appropriate status icon
and the Encryption On or Encryption Off message.
